Oh for a kindling touch from that pure flame | B |
Which ministered erewhile to a sacrifice | C |
Of gratitude beneath Italian skies | D |
In words like these 'Up Voice of song proclaim | B |
'Thy saintly rapture with celestial aim | B |
'For lo the Imperial City stands released | E |
'From bondage threatened by the embattled East | E |
'And Christendom respires from guilt and shame | B |
'Redeemed from miserable fear set free | A |
'By one day's feat one mighty victory | A |
' Chant the Deliverer's praise in every tongue | F |
'The cross shall spread the crescent hath waxed dim | G |
'He conquering as in joyful Heaven is sung | F |
'HE CONQUERING THROUGH GOD AND GOD BY HIM ' | - |
William Wordsworth
